When It’s Time to Get Your AC Repaired
Is the level of convenience in your home disappointing what you would like it to be? There are other, more subtle problems that, if neglected, could result in more extreme repair work or the need for an early replacement of your a/c unit. While a unit that won’t switch on is a clear sign that you require repairs, there are other, less apparent problems. If you recognize with the more subtle signs of a issue with your a/c, you will be able to call a professional service professional quicker rather than later.
If any of the following use, one of our Iowa AC repair experts encourages that you give us a call:
- You are sustaining an boost in the amount of cash required to spend for your month-to-month energy bills: Inefficient operation of your ac system can be triggered by a number of different issues, including leaking ductwork, an internal malfunction, or a defective thermostat. This suggests that it needs to work more difficult to keep your home cool, which will result in a substantial boost in the quantity that you pay in energy costs.
- You only discover hot air coming out of your vents: First things initially, make sure you haven’t inadvertently set the thermostat to the inaccurate temperature level by examining it. If that is not the case, then you probably have a problem on the within your a/c, and you need to get it checked by a expert.
- You are seeing a higher humidity level at your residential or commercial property: Even though this is not the main function of your ac system, it is accountable for regulating the humidity level inside of your home or commercial building. Greater humidity suggests that there is an excess of wetness in the air, which can result in the growth of mold and mildew in addition to making the air feel warm and sticky. It is necessary that you get this matter dealt with as rapidly as humanly feasible, particularly for the sake of your security.
- The airflow in your system is inadequate: Regrettably, there are a wide array of aspects that can result in inadequate airflow. We will require to perform a extensive inspection in order to find out whether the issue is the result of a clogged up air filter, an problem with the blower, frozen evaporator coils, dripping ductwork, or blocked air ducts.
- You observe that there is a considerable quantity of moisture in the location around your system: Condensation is a natural incident, nevertheless it should not be present in extreme quantities. It is possible that you have a leaking refrigerant or a blocked drain tube if you observe any excess wetness or pooling water in the location.
- Weird Noises from Your Unit: It is to be anticipated for an a/c to develop some background sound while it is running. On the other hand, if it begins making audible shrieking, squealing, grinding, groaning, or scraping sounds, this is an obvious indicator that something requires to be fixed.
- It appears that there is a issue with your thermostat: It’s possible that the thermostat is the source of the issues you’re having with your air conditioner. If you have cold and hot areas around your home, your unit won’t shut down, or it won’t begin, it could be because of a issue with the thermostat. If your unit won’t start, it might likewise be due to the fact that it won’t shut down.
- Foul odors are originating from your unit: There might be a problem with your AC if you smell anything burning or a musty odor. These odors can be triggered by a range of aspects, consisting of mold development and charred electrical wiring.
- Your unit rotates frequently between the following states: When the temperature level inside your home reaches the level that you have actually selected on the thermostat, air conditioning unit are set to turn off instantly. Regardless of this, it will continue to cycle even when there is something incorrect with it.

The HVAC System Is Making Weird Noises
There are a few noises that need to not be heard originating from ac system although they do not run completely silence. These sounds might be anything from a banging to a shrieking to a grinding to a clicking noise. These particular sounds almost always suggest that there is a issue within the air conditioning system that has to be repaired by a expert of in Polk County.
Sounds that are Weird and Different Coming From Your a/c The following ought to be included:
- Banging: The problem is usually the compressor in an air conditioning system that is making a banging sound. This element of the a/c is accountable for providing refrigerant to the various other parts of the system in order to get rid of excess heat from your home. Compressor components might relax as the air conditioner system ages. This sound is triggered by the parts moving around and rattling and crashing one another.
- Screeching: A broken blower fan motor within the air conditioner may produce a sound similar to shrieking or screeching if the motor is working poorly. Generally, a defective fan belt or damaged bearings in the motor are to blame for this sound. Turn off the air conditioner right away and connect with a expert for repair work whenever you hear a screeching sound.
- Grinding: The sound of something grinding is never a good indication to hear originating from any type of mechanical item. Pistons inside the compressor might have worn, which may result in this grinding sound emanating from the air conditioning. When a compressor’s pistons become worn, it often shows that the compressor itself has to be replaced. The total AC system could need to be changed depending upon the model of AC and how old it is.
- Clicking: It is really typical for an ac system to make a clicking sound when it initially turns on. If you hear clicking throughout the whole duration of the cooling cycle, then there is a issue with the clicking. These clicks are the result of a thermostat that is not working effectively.
